At first I was very young and I always wanted to wait a little bit and mature in all aspects before making such an important decision. It all comes from my paternal grandfather. equatorial guinea. my father was born in tenerife island However, they lived there for many years immediately after their birth, and one of their brothers was born. equatorial guinea. Everything comes from the father. Ultimately, I made the decision, and it’s one of the decisions I’m most proud of that I’ve made in my career. ”
